About This Image:

In June 1981, as part of Singapore's ongoing urban development, the Housing and Development Board (HDB) initiated the construction of residential blocks along Marsiling Drive, a lane connected to Marsiling Road. Situated side by side at the junction of Marsiling Road and Admiralty Road, two new schools—Siling Primary and Siling Secondary—were established on land that was formerly a rubber plantation.
